Transaction c72707192b841820b33f7c337bf41da5c72a241e63c1d4d1f0723f4134bae81b
1 Input
2 Outputs
- c72707192b841820b33f7c337bf41da5c72a241e63c1d4d1f0723f4134bae81b:0
- c72707192b841820b33f7c337bf41da5c72a241e63c1d4d1f0723f4134bae81b:1
value 423209875
address 12EcLPMjEW45RUtDBhb17fBC145s999V8z
value 367281
address 1KiiWj27KeoQrUHETgKts3wTFNBQ3DwEX6